A parliamentary report undermines the financing of private schools. The report was signed by LFI deputies Paul Vannier and Renaissance Christopher Weissberg.

It must be presented Tuesday afternoon to the Committee on Cultural Affairs and Education at the National Assembly. Public resources benefiting the sector amount to 9.04 billion euros in 2024, but "despite the sums involved", the allocation of this expenditure is "not very transparent", the report says. The document also points to “blind spots” in the educational control of establishments, including “the proper application of provisions relating to religious instruction”
